CARICOM Secretariat and CRITI collaborate to mount booth at CARIFESTA XII
The CARICOM Secretariat team and the Caribbean Regional Information and Translation Institute (CRITI) have collaborated to mount a booth at the Grand Market for CARIFESTA XII in Haiti. The booth features promotional information about both organizations, and visitors get to take away some CARICOM and CRITI memorabilia. Check out these photos for a glimpse of the items on display.

Regional Cultural Committee meets in Haiti on CARIFESTA XII
The Caribbean Community (CARICOM) Regional Cultural Committee (RCC) is currently in Haiti for its twenty-third meeting from 8-9 July, 2015. The main topic for discussion is preparation for the Twelfth Caribbean Festival of Art (CARIFESTA XII) which will take place across five cities in Haiti from 21-30 August, 2015.
